Polish engineer unit to leave for Chad late April

An engineer unit of Poland will leave for Chad in late April or early May to prepare a base for Polish soldiers there, Polish news agency PAP reported on Sunday.

The unit would be strongly supported by the French side, Polish Defense Minister Bogdan Klich was quoted by PAP as saying on Saturday.

French Defense Minister Herve Morin is to confirm the project in the coming days, Klich said.

Klich was attending a discussion in Cracow on "New architecture of security in Europe. The role and position of Poland."

Poland plans to deploy up to 400 troops and army employees in Chad whose task will be patrolling and the protection of humanitarian aid convoys.
